End of the Beginning garden is all the quirky, eclectic, whimsical, joyful notions we have mustered and cobbled together in one woodland place in Pennsylvania. For some sixteen or so years, our home and gardens have been invented and reinvented - ever emerging, ever evolving- it is all about blending art and craft with nature, integrating what is magnificently artificial with what is always spectacularly natural.
Sometimes it is about tweaking and rearranging natural things in an artful way (i.e., garden design, landscaping, and hardscaping). Then it might be about the Garden Angel pulling only some of the vines away from trees and twisting them to make something artful. Sometimes it is about melting a structure into its surroundings as if it grew from the garden. Then it is moving a heavy sculpture two or three times before it is right. Then we move the sculpture again, on another day, to a better right spot...or worse. Sometimes it is about showing an artist a woodland place and having the artist respond to it by creating for the space with masses of artistic license and freedom.
It is always about giving people a chance to be creative, having respect for individual gifts - encouraging, nudging, and considering- this garden place is forever at the End of the Beginning.
The art is trying to take over - it couldn't help itself - like magnificent weeds. Even a garage is a gallery in the End of the Beginning Garden.
